Beta-Carotene (β – carotene)
Name Beta-Carotene (β – carotene)
Molecular Formula C40H56
Molecular Weight 536.88
CAS No. 7235-40-7
Characteristics
β - carotene (C40H56) is one of the carotenoids, an orange fat soluble compound that is the most common and stable natural pigment in nature. Belonging to the family of natural chemicals such as carotenoids or carotenoids. It is abundant in plants, giving fruits and vegetables a full yellow and orange color. The pure product appears as a red purple to dark red crystalline powder with a slight distinctive odor. The dilute solution of β - carotene appears orange yellow and is easily soluble in organic solvents such as dichloromethane, chloroform, and carbon disulfide. When the concentration of the solution increases, it turns orange, but due to the polarity of the solvent, it may slightly turn red. Unstable when exposed to oxygen, heat, and light. It is relatively stable in weak alkali.
β - carotene is widely used in the food industry, feed industry, pharmaceutical and cosmetics industry.

Function
1. Protect Eyes
Carotenoids are important nutrients necessary for the normal development and maintenance of human retina function. Carotenoid deficiency can lead to night blindness, making it difficult for patients to see clearly in dimly lit environments. Therefore, moderate intake of carotenoids is beneficial for protecting the eyes and helping us maintain normal retinal function.
